Andre Soukhamthath believes he has edge over Kin Moy at CES 21

Andre SoukhamthathThe 25- year-old, Andre “The Asian Sensation” Soukhamthath (7-1) will return to his home of Rhode Island this Friday night to face undefeated prospect Kin “Kong” Moy (5-0) at Classic Entertainment and Sports’ (CES) MMA 21.

In December, Soukhamthath defeated Corey Simmons  via TKO at CES MMA 20.The victory marked Soukhamthath’s seventh career victory, also his seventh win inside the CES cage. Previous to that fight, Soukhamthath defeated Billy Vaughan at CES: Rise or Fall by key lock in the opening round.

Soukhamthath now resides in Boca Raton, FLa. where he trains at the Blackzilians’ facility. Soukhamthath has the opportunity to train alongside fighters like Rashad Evans, Vitor Belfort, Anthony Johnson, Michael Johnson, and many more. ”Just by working with guys who are on another level, I feel like I’m improving everyday,” Soukhamthath said.

Moy will enter the CES cage for the 2nd time in his professional career. Moy is undefeated with 3 wins coming by the way of submission. Moy is a talented fighter, but Soukhamthat is a step-up in competition. ”I’ve seen him through the years,” Soukhamthath said. “I don’t think he’s a better athlete than me, and that is where my advantage will be.”
